[Qemu-devel] [PATCH 2/4] multiboot: load elf sections and section header


From: Anatol Pomozov
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 2/4] multiboot: load elf sections and section headers
Date: Mon, 29 Jan 2018 12:43:42 -0800

Multiboot may load section headers and all sections (even those that are
not part of any segment) to target memory.

Tested with an ELF application that uses data from strings table
section.

@@ -481,6 +480,109 @@ static int glue(load_elf, SZ)(const char *name, int fd,
         }
     }
     g_free(phdr);
+
+    if (sections) {
+        struct elf_shdr *shdr = NULL, *sh;
+        int shsize;
+
+        /* user requested loading all ELF sections */
+        shsize = ehdr.e_shnum * sizeof(shdr[0]);
+        if (lseek(fd, ehdr.e_shoff, SEEK_SET) != ehdr.e_shoff) {
+            goto fail;
+        }
+        shdr = g_malloc0(shsize);
+        if (read(fd, shdr, shsize) != shsize) {
+            goto fail;
+        }
+        if (must_swab) {
+            for (i = 0; i < ehdr.e_shnum; i++) {
+                sh = &shdr[i];
+                glue(bswap_shdr, SZ)(sh);
+            }
+        }
+
+        for (i = 0; i < ehdr.e_shnum; i++) {
+            sh = &shdr[i];
+            if (sh->sh_type == SHT_NULL) {
+                continue;
+            }
+            /* if section has address then it loaded already,
+             * no need to load it again */
+            if (sh->sh_addr) {
+                continue;
+            }
+
+            /* append section data at the end of the loaded segments */
+            addr = ROUND_UP(high, sh->sh_addralign);
+            sh->sh_addr = addr;
+
+            sec_size = sh->sh_size; /* Size of the section data */
+            data = g_malloc0(sec_size);
+            if (sec_size > 0) {
+                if (lseek(fd, sh->sh_offset, SEEK_SET) < 0) {
+                    goto fail;
+                }
+                if (read(fd, data, sec_size) != sec_size) {
+                    goto fail;
+                }
+            }
+
+            /* As these sections are not loadable no need to perform reloaction
+             * using translate_fn() */
+            if (data_swab) {
+                int j;
+                for (j = 0; j < sec_size; j += (1 << data_swab)) {
+                    uint8_t *dp = data + j;
+                    switch (data_swab) {
+                    case 1:
+                        *(uint16_t *)dp = bswap16(*(uint16_t *)dp);
+                        break;
+                    case 2:
+                        *(uint32_t *)dp = bswap32(*(uint32_t *)dp);
+                        break;
+                    case 3:
+                        *(uint64_t *)dp = bswap64(*(uint64_t *)dp);
+                        break;
+                    default:
+                        g_assert_not_reached();
+                    }
+                }
+            }
+
+            if (load_rom) {
+                snprintf(label, sizeof(label), "shdr #%d: %s", i, name);
+
+                /* rom_add_elf_program() seize the ownership of 'data' */
+                rom_add_elf_program(label, data, sec_size, sec_size, addr, as);
+            } else {
+                cpu_physical_memory_write(addr, data, sec_size);
+                g_free(data);
+            }
+
+            total_size += sec_size;
+            high = addr + sec_size;
+
+            data = NULL;
+        }
+
+        sections->num = ehdr.e_shnum;
+        sections->size = ehdr.e_shentsize;
+        sections->addr = high; /* Address where we load the sections header */
+        sections->shndx = ehdr.e_shstrndx;
+
+        /* Append section headers at the end of loaded segments/sections */
+        if (load_rom) {
+            snprintf(label, sizeof(label), "shdrs");
+
+            /* rom_add_elf_program() seize the ownership of 'shdr' */
+            rom_add_elf_program(label, shdr, shsize, shsize, high, as);
+        } else {
+            cpu_physical_memory_write(high, shdr, shsize);
+            g_free(shdr);
+        }
+        high += shsize;
+    }
